General Description

  • The E4 – Engineer is a professional engineer or geoscientist who applies engineering knowledge to provide engineering, estimating, planning, and quality management services for medium complexity projects and/or operations safely, with quality, within budget, and on time.


The Stations Equipment groups require equipment engineers with knowledge in, air insulated, medium voltage (2.4kV to 69kV) substation switchgear and reactive equipment to support their replacement programs.

Responsibilities

  • This role requires experience with the design of electrical utility substations with operating voltages from 12kV to 500kV and demonstrated experience working with utility design solutions in an electric utility environment.
  • This position is needed to help with an increasing workload in capital projects, emergency replacement and restoration work, asset management strategic OMA work programs and Owners Engineer review work.
  • The position requires specialized knowledge of electrical power equipment so the ideal candidate would have some experience with the specification and installation of substation electrical equipment.
  • Experience in one or both of the reactive or switchgear equipment areas is required.

Key aspects of the reactive equipment area include:
o series capacitor stations
o STATCOMS and power transformers
o shunt reactors

Key aspects of the switchgear equipment area include:
o HV circuit breakers up to 550kV
o HV & MV GIS
o circuit switchers
